## Who to ping about GiftNote

Welcome aboard! GiftNote is our donation-receipt mailer for the Larchfield Fund. Template tweaks go to the comms folks; delivery failures and bounce weirdness go to the platform crew. Don't push template changes on Fridays — receipts batch over the weekend. For anything GiftNote-related, start with the address below.

billing contact of kaweg-tajeg = drudor.lamion.oliath@torvalabs.test

## Alert: StatRelay Sidecar Flush Lag

This alert fires when the StatRelay metrics-aggregation sidecar falls more than 120 seconds behind on flushing buffered samples to the Coalmine backend. Plugin-emitted counters are buffered in-process, so sustained lag usually means a plugin is emitting unbounded label cardinality or blocking the flush thread. Check your plugin's metric registration against the published cardinality limits before escalating. If the lag persists after your plugin is ruled out, contact the telemetry team.

escalation mailbox, bagug-fahof: novdor.wendor.jormir@norvalabs.example

**Payslip run — Marnwick Depot**

Quick reminder: Marnwick still has no working printer, so payslips for the depot crew get printed here at Ostley House every second Thursday. Use the blue tamper-evident envelopes from the stationery cupboard, one per person, sealed and initialled. Don't batch them loose in a folder — we had complaints about that last quarter. The courier from Fennik Express collects from reception around 10:30. Before they leave, make sure the run sheet is signed. The hand-over instruction for the courier is as follows:

handover note for yagef-bagep: the drudor pelius courier leaves the kasdor zorvan norir ledger at gate 8016 under passcode 755406